Biogeographical and ecological theory suggests that species distributions should be driven to higher altitudes and latitudes as global temperatures rise. Such changes occur as growth improves at the poleward edge of a species distribution and declines at the range edge in the opposite or equatorial direction, mirrored by changes in the establishment of new individuals. Drought-induced xylem embolism is a key process closely related to plant mortality during extreme drought events. However, this process has been poorly investigated in crop species to date, despite the observed decline of crop productivity under extreme drought conditions. As other crops, oilseed rape (Brassica napus L.) is severely affected under drought conditions. The mechanisms which reduce damages caused by oxidative stress have important roles in resistance of plants to drought stress and antioxidant enzymes have primed importance in this regards.
